Output e17ed540dc0a144f7c11f963ed65659a1d4d89e829b6f2b9acfee10192f9179e:0

value
699684287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e2e3b25dfa077b641d8b398b7510626a87ab57 OP_EQUAL
address
39X9AQPQuqpDsvod7T2y9pq6sZZoTpknsZ
transaction
e17ed540dc0a144f7c11f963ed65659a1d4d89e829b6f2b9acfee10192f9179e
spent
true